Overlap with Financial Regulations

Crash games that utilize cryptocurrency often find themselves in a gray area, as they straddle the line between gambling and financial activities. Regulators are grappling with the question of whether these games should be subject to financial regulations, such as anti-money laundering (AML) and know-your-customer (KYC) requirements, in addition to gambling-specific laws.

Addressing Addiction and Harm Reduction

Crash games, combined with the anonymity and ease of access provided by cryptocurrencies, can increase the risk of problem gambling and addiction. Providers and regulators must work together to implement robust responsible gambling frameworks, including tools for self-exclusion, deposit limits, and player education.
